| Lily germplasm resources in China are abundant,however,the popular varieties in the market are cultivated abroad,The bulbs rely on imports,and the breeding technology is backward.Bulbs degradation is the bottleneck that restricts the development of lily industry in China,In order to realize the domestication of bulbs,it is necessary to explore the regularity,physiology,biochemistry and related molecular mechanisms of the occurrence and propagation of lily bulbs.Reproductive method includes seed propagation,scale cutting,bulbil propagation,and tissue culture.bulbil propagation that is an excellent method for lily bulb propagation,shortens the growth cycle,has a high degree of homogenization,and the advantages of high survival rate,high yield,and low toxicity rate.In this study,the histological and morphological observations were carried out to study the development process of Lilium bulbil.In order to determine the dynamic changes of endogenous hormones during the formation of the bulbil,the endogenous hormone content was determined by ELISA.Spraying the exogenous GR-24 and Tis-108 solution,IAA and NPA solution at the leaf axil to establish a method for regulating lily bulbils.Main research results is obtained as follows:(1)The bulbils is produced in the near axial surface of the base of the young petioles,and the internal cells is relatively small.The growth rate of the outer scales of the bulbils is faster,the scales is cracked,there is a formed bulbil structure,and the developing bulbils don’t have obvious root structure differentiation.(2)The contents of ABA,iPA and JA-me decreased,and the ratios of ABA/GA3 and ABA/GA4 decreased,which promoted the sprouting of bulblets;the contents of ABA and IAA increased,and high levels of IAA/iPA,IAA/GA3 and IAA/GA4 promoted bulb bud enlargement.When the shoots are mature,the ZR content is the lowest,and high levels of ABA/IAA,ABA/ZR promote bud ripening.(3)GR-24 treatment delays the occurrence of bulbils,Tis-108 treatment promotes the growth and development of bulbils,IAA treatment promotes the development of bulbils,NPA treatment significantly inhibits the occurrence of bulbils.In view of the present situation of Chinese Lily seed industry,this study explored the physiological and biochemical mechanism of the hormonal signal response to the occurrence and morphogenesis of the bulbils,and provided a theoretical basis for the analysis of the molecular mechanism and related regulatory genes of lily bulbils,and provided support for the production of lily bulbils. |
